一、小型AI设备与多模态模型协同的技术背景
随着边缘计算与生成式AI技术的深度融合,小型AI设备与多模态大模型的协同应用正成为行业焦点。这类设备通常具备低功耗、高集成度的硬件特性,而多模态模型则需处理文本、图像、语音等复杂数据。两者的结合面临三大核心挑战:硬件算力限制、模型体积压缩、实时性要求。
以某主流边缘计算设备为例,其CPU主频1.2GHz、内存2GB的配置,远低于云端GPU集群的算力水平。而多模态模型参数量普遍超过10亿,直接部署会导致推理延迟超过500ms。因此,技术突破需聚焦硬件适配优化、模型轻量化、异构计算加速三个方向。
二、硬件适配优化:从架构设计到资源调度
1. 异构计算架构设计
边缘设备通常集成CPU、NPU、DSP等多类计算单元。例如某平台采用的”CPU+NPU”异构架构,通过动态任务分配实现:
- NPU处理矩阵运算(如卷积层)
- CPU处理逻辑控制(如分支判断)
- DSP加速音频信号处理
# 异构任务调度示例def hetero_schedule(task):if task.type == 'matrix':npu_queue.put(task)elif task.type == 'control':cpu_queue.put(task)elif task.type == 'audio':dsp_queue.put(task)
2. 内存管理优化
针对2GB内存限制,需采用分块加载与内存复用技术:
- 模型参数分块存储(每块≤50MB)
- 输入数据流式处理
- 中间结果共享缓存池
某设备实测显示,通过内存复用技术可将峰值内存占用从1.8GB降至920MB,同时保持98%的推理精度。
3. 功耗控制策略
动态电压频率调整(DVFS)技术可根据负载实时调整:
- 空闲状态:CPU 400MHz / NPU休眠
- 推理状态:CPU 1.2GHz / NPU满载
- 突发负载:启用DSP协处理器
测试数据显示,该策略使设备平均功耗降低37%,续航时间延长至8小时。
三、模型轻量化:量化压缩与结构优化
1. 混合精度量化
采用INT8+FP16混合量化方案:
- 权重参数:INT8量化(压缩率4倍)
- 激活值:FP16保留(避免精度损失)
- 关键层:FP32原样保留
某视觉模型实测表明,混合量化使模型体积从480MB降至120MB,推理速度提升2.3倍,精度损失仅1.2%。
2. 结构化剪枝
通过通道重要性评估进行层级剪枝:
# 基于L1范数的通道剪枝def channel_pruning(layer, prune_ratio=0.3):weights = layer.weight.datal1_norm = weights.abs().sum(dim=[1,2,3])threshold = l1_norm.quantile(prune_ratio)mask = l1_norm > thresholdreturn weights[:, mask, :, :]
在某语言模型上应用后,参数量减少58%,推理延迟从120ms降至45ms。
3. 知识蒸馏技术
采用教师-学生架构进行模型压缩:
- 教师模型:13亿参数多模态模型
- 学生模型:3000万参数轻量模型
- 损失函数:KL散度+特征匹配
训练后学生模型在边缘设备上达到教师模型92%的准确率,推理速度提升18倍。
四、场景化部署:从实验室到产业落地
1. 工业质检场景
某制造企业部署方案:
- 硬件:边缘计算盒子(4核ARM+1TOPS NPU)
- 模型:缺陷检测轻量模型(体积87MB)
- 流程:
- 摄像头实时采集(1080P@30fps)
- 边缘设备本地推理(延迟<80ms)
- 缺陷结果上传云端
部署后检测准确率达99.3%,较传统方案效率提升4倍。
2. 智能安防场景
低功耗门禁系统实现:
- 硬件:电池供电设备(日均功耗<2Wh)
- 优化:
- 模型动态唤醒(仅在检测到人脸时激活)
- 输入分辨率自适应(160x160~640x480)
- 指标:
- 识别速度:120ms/人
- 续航时间:6个月(4节AA电池)
3. 医疗辅助场景
便携式超声诊断设备:
- 硬件:移动端SoC(6核CPU+0.5TOPS GPU)
- 优化:
- 模型分阶段处理(先分类后分割)
- 输入数据压缩(JPEG2000编码)
- 效果:
- 病灶识别准确率91.7%
- 单次检查耗电<5%
五、开发者实践指南
1. 开发环境搭建
推荐配置:
- 硬件:某主流边缘开发板(4GB内存)
- 框架:TensorFlow Lite/PyTorch Mobile
- 工具链:模型量化工具+交叉编译器
2. 性能优化路线
- 基准测试:建立延迟/功耗/精度基线
- 量化压缩:从FP32逐步降至INT8
- 架构调整:尝试不同异构计算分配
- 迭代优化:每轮调整后重新测试
3. 典型问题解决方案
- 内存不足:启用模型分块加载,减少同时驻留参数
- 过热问题:限制NPU峰值功耗,增加散热设计
- 精度下降:采用渐进式量化,保留关键层高精度
六、未来技术演进方向
- 神经拟态计算:探索脉冲神经网络(SNN)的边缘部署
- 动态模型架构:研发可根据硬件状态自动调整的模型
- 联邦学习集成:实现边缘设备间的协同训练
- 光子计算芯片:研究光互连架构的AI加速可能性
当前技术发展显示,通过硬件-算法-系统的协同优化,小型AI设备与多模态模型的协同效能每年提升约40%。预计到2026年,主流边缘设备将具备支持10亿参数模型实时推理的能力,为智能制造、智慧城市等领域开辟新的应用空间。开发者应重点关注异构计算架构设计、模型量化压缩技术,以及场景化的性能调优方法,以把握边缘智能发展的技术红利。